Dubai, United Arab Emirates, April 23, 2020: Instagram is marking Ramadan by bringing back its global initiative – ‘Month of Good’ – for a second year, inviting its community to come together and spread kindness on the platform. In recognition of the new realities that are keeping loved ones apart during the Holy Month, Instagram is encouraging people to inspire each other to do and share good deeds during the month.
Ramadan is one of the key moments on Instagram with over 16 million uses of the word ‘Ramadan’ on Instagram in 2019 alone. This year, Instagram has seen the global community gearing up for Ramadan, with references to Ramadan already hitting 4 million in the past 30 days and a 40 per cent growth in the usage of the word “kindness” on the platform across the world.
Here is what Instagram will be doing over the month:
● They are inviting the Instagram community to share their acts of good — big or small — over the course of the month and to encourage others to do the same, using the hashtag #MonthofGood
● It can be something as simple as giving thanks to healthcare professionals, posting a positive comment, or hosting a virtual iftar to bring together friends and family from around the world.
● They have put together a few ideas on how to spread kindness on Instagram to help inspire the community.
● They are bringing back Instagram’s Ramadan camera effect; ‘Lantern’, which features iconography associated with Ramadan and includes greetings in English, Arabic, Bahasa, Turkish and Farsi. It can be found through searching for ‘Lantern’ in Camera effects.
● Throughout the month, @Instagram will feature content creators from around the world who will share their key Ramadan moments.
To kickstart the #MonthofGood, Instagram roped in global beauty entrepreneur Huda Kattan of @Hudabeauty to kick off the month with a feed post on @instagram, citing what kindness means to her and who she is challenging to take this message forward.
